Hi all,

recently got a brand new Alienware PC, with Vista installed.

Found whilst playing Warcraft online, that sometimes when i type, the PC
actually "beeps" at me.

Several times, my character has got stuck running in a certain direction
when this beep occurs. If you press any other direction buttons he keeps
running forwards - until you press the forward button itself and it seems to
switch it off.

now it also seems to happen when im actually in Windows itself, for example
its beeped twice already during this message. Sometimes it puts my caps lock
on (but the caps lock light is off).

Anyone else experienced this? Alienware and Blizzard both think its
something to do with the sticky keys but im not sure

help?

Yes, it sounds like Sticky Keys. It's normally turned on when you press
Shift 5 times...

Go to Control Panel - Ease of Access Center
Make the keyboard easier to use
See if Turn on Sticky keys is checked.
